What you might want to just get the layout of the site done, how you want it to look. From that, you will be able to break it down into the header & footer files that the store will use.
You will want to set up your products in the database of the manager.
It is really good to first set up the manager, and to play around with the default products that are in the store, before trying to customize it. Then, you will have a good idea of how the cart functions and be able to identify what may have caused an error when you begin customizing.
When you start customizing the cart and editing the raw files of AgoraCart, do NOT use a WYSIWYG editor or the online editor in your cpanel. Use a plain html editor (I have some listed on my resources site:
http://resources.scottcrew.com/soft.htm ) . Also, don't use the file manager in the cpanel to upload files. Use a simple FTP program, again, I some of those listed, too.
Always FTP files in ASCII mode and graphics in binary mode.
